What is Nanoelectron-volt to Milliwatt-hour Conversion?

Nanoelectron-volt (neV) and milliwatt-hour (mWh) are both units used to measure energy, but they serve different purposes depending on the scale of the measurement. If you ever need to convert nanoelectron-volt to milliwatt-hour, knowing the exact conversion formula is essential.

NeV to mwh Conversion Formula:

One Nanoelectron-volt is equal to 4.450491e-29 Milliwatt-hour.

Formula: 1 neV = 4.450491e-29 mWh

By using this conversion factor, you can easily convert any energy from nanoelectron-volt to milliwatt-hour with precision.
